I wrote about Zweihander, the Grim & Perilous RPG developed, unsurprisingly, by Grim & Perilous Studios and Daniel D. Fox, back in 2017, when I got a copy of the basic handbook in PDF and was quite positively impressed.
Basically, Zweihander is a retro-clone of the classic Warhammer Fantasy RPG (WHFRPG) that made it big – it cleans up the rules and it straightens up a few of the glitches of the olf First and Second editions of WHFRP, and while preserving all the good parts of the old game, it also adds a few bits and pieces – the core rulebook is a hefty 672 pages. The hardback edition is impressive and rather costly – but you can get the PDF version for less than 15 bucks.
